Understanding Biodegradable Ingredients ​and Their‍ Effectiveness

Biodegradable ingredients ⁢are derived from⁣ natural ⁣sources and designed to break down⁤ more⁢ easily in the environment compared ‌to their synthetic counterparts. ‍These ingredients frequently enough‍ include ​ plant-based surfactants, essential ⁤oils, and ⁣ natural enzymes which not only help ​to ⁣clean surfaces effectively but⁢ also ‍minimize harmful residue left behind.⁢ The ​effectiveness of biodegradable cleaners lies ‍in​ their ability to‍ harness the power of⁢ nature in tackling dirt and grime, providing a sustainable option⁢ without compromising on⁤ performance. Some common biodegradable components include:

  • Fatty ⁢Acid⁣ Esters: Derived‍ from vegetable oils, effective in breaking down grease.
  • Citric Acid: A ‌natural antiseptic that can disinfect and remove stains.
  • Vinegar: Known for‍ its‌ strong cleaning properties, notably in descaling.

Comparing Performance: Biodegradable Cleaners vs. Traditional solutions

When evaluating the⁤ effectiveness of biodegradable cleaners against traditional solutions, several factors come into ​play, including their cleaning power, speed of​ action, and environmental impact. Biodegradable products often‍ rely on natural ingredients like plant‌ extracts and ⁣enzymes,⁤ which can be as effective in breaking down dirt and grime as their⁤ chemical-laden counterparts. In many cases, ‌they ‍provide ‍similar⁢ results⁢ without the harsh⁢ chemicals, ⁣making them suitable⁤ for sensitive ⁤environments, such as ​homes ⁢with ⁣children ⁣or ​pets. However, some users find⁣ that biodegradable cleaners ‌may⁢ require slightly more time ‌or effort to achieve the desired‌ level‌ of​ cleanliness, ⁢particularly on‍ tough stains or in heavy-duty situations.

Another aspect to consider is the longevity⁣ and ⁢ concentration of biodegradable​ products‌ compared to traditional solutions. Contrary ⁢to common belief, many biodegradable cleaners ​are⁢ designed to be concentrated,​ meaning you can achieve the same ⁢cleaning⁤ efficacy with smaller quantities. This ⁣not only makes them⁢ cost-effective over⁤ time but also reduces waste,aligning with environmentally ⁢conscious practices. ‌Below ​is a comparison summary based on ‍common characteristics:

Environmental Impact: Beyond Cleaning‌ Efficacy

While ‍cleaning efficacy is‍ an essential criteria for choosing ⁣a ‍cleaning product,the environmental impact of ‌those products ​plays a⁤ crucial role in ‌their overall ⁤value.​ Biodegradable ⁢cleaning agents are ​designed‍ to break ⁤down into ⁤natural​ elements ⁢after use, reducing⁢ their ecological footprint. This⁣ contrasts with traditional ‍cleaners, which often contain⁢ harsh‌ chemicals‍ that can persist in the‍ environment, possibly harming wildlife and contaminating‌ water sources. The choice of cleaning⁤ product can influence various⁢ environmental factors, including:

  • Water Quality: biodegradable cleaners typically release ⁣fewer toxins⁤ into⁤ our waterways, contributing‍ to healthier aquatic ecosystems.
  • Air ⁤Quality: Many eco-friendly products⁢ use natural fragrances and⁤ non-toxic formulations, ⁤reducing the release of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) ⁤that can pollute indoor ⁤air.
  • Packaging‌ Waste: ​Increasingly, manufacturers of biodegradable products‍ are opting for sustainable packaging solutions that further minimize‌ environmental degradation.

Making the Switch:‍ Tips for Choosing Effective Biodegradable Products

When transitioning‌ to‌ biodegradable cleaning products,it’s essential to consider factors ⁤that⁣ can ​influence both effectiveness ​and environmental impact. First and foremost, look for certification​ labels that‍ indicate the ‍product ⁣meets specific environmental standards. These certifications ‍often reflect ⁢not only biodegradability but⁢ also the absence of harmful chemicals.Additionally, pay attention to the ingredients list; products⁣ made⁤ with plant-based or naturally​ derived ingredients are‍ often gentler on both ​your health​ and the planet. It’s beneficial to choose ⁤cleaners that ‍specify ‌the presence‌ of active enzymes, which can ​enhance cleaning power while remaining eco-friendly.

Another ⁢aspect to‍ evaluate is the product format ⁢ you prefer, as this ‍can affect usage​ and ⁤effectiveness.‌ For example,liquid cleaners ​may ‍be more ​versatile ‍then powders,while concentrated forms often reduce packaging​ waste and⁣ shipping emissions.
